Transaction 21ccad3ff3bbfda1d79f9bb04761e005a7772c591238990d0b4c7ef3dfe51c76

3 Input
2 Outputs
  • 21ccad3ff3bbfda1d79f9bb04761e005a7772c591238990d0b4c7ef3dfe51c76:0
  • value  3000000000
    address  17cwWT84KFoSjW19GByKNhD8dCUqtPRC7U
  • 21ccad3ff3bbfda1d79f9bb04761e005a7772c591238990d0b4c7ef3dfe51c76:1
  • value  364472799
    address  bc1q7uzjlx7z0ytwcf29rz4rr7cgpley3zp62mpry9